1412 points for Norwegian Morten Boe
Lausanne - 4 June 2007
The compound archer Morten Boe shot 1412 points on a FITA Round at the Akkerhaugen Star Tournament in Norway on Sunday 3 June. This his only two points lower than the World Record held since 2001 by Roger Hoyle (USA).
Morten Boe's scores at the four distances (90m, 70m, 50m and 30m) were as follows: 344-356-352-360. His 356 points at 70 metres ties the current World Record held by another American Dave Cousins since May 2005.
